4. Ensure that WAN DNS settings are set to Obtain Automatically, and DHCP DNS is set to OpenDNS
To make OpenDNS work properly, please ensure that the setting for WAN DNS (first screenshot) is set to obtain dynamically, and configure the settings for the DHCP DNS (second screenshot) to 208.67.220.220 and 208.67.222.222. Then flush the DNS caches on the computer.
5. Check your Settings
Please visit http://welcome.opendns.com to confirm that you're using OpenDNS. If so, you may visit your Dashboard to start configuring your account's settings at http://dashboard.opendns.com.
